OH Skeletal Remains ID’d As Missing Cincinnati Woman Nickiesha Holloman

CINCINNATI, OH. (THECOUNT) — Missing woman, Nickiesha Holloman, has been identified as the skeletal remains found along a Mount Airy street in a vacant lot.

Holloman, 23, was last seen at the The Crossroads Center, on Burnet Avenue, in Cincinnati, OH, where she was living, police said.

Her death has been ruled a homicide, officials with the Cincinnati Police Department said.

The bones were found in late August in the 1800 block of Mehmert Avenue, officials said, found in a vacant lot.

Following a lengthy investigation with the coroner’s office, police identified the remains as that of 23-year-old Nickiesha Holloman. source

No further information has been provided.

Holloman had been missing since July 1.
